Abstract: Introductory materials for a revision of the milliped family Trichopetalidae are presented, and the species of three of the five genera are described (Nannopetalum n. gen., Trigenotyla Causey, 1951, Causeyella, n. gen.). Nannopetalum is related to Trichopetalum, and includes three new species from the Appalachian piedmont: N. pattersonorum (Virginia), N. vespertilio (North Carolina), and N. fontis (Alabama). Trigenotyla Causey includes four species: T. parca Causey (Arkansas), T. vaga Causey (Oklahoma), T. blacki n. sp. (Oklahoma), and T. seminole n. sp. (Oklahoma). Causeyella n. gen. is based on Scoterpes dendropus Loomis (Missouri and Arkansas), and also contains two new species: C. causeyae n. sp. (Arkansas) and C. youngsteatorum n. sp. (Arkansas). Causeyella and Trigenotyla are closely related.
